Webb16 aug. 2024 · Newton’s first law states that an object will remain at rest or in uniform motion in a straight line unless acted upon by an external force. This law, also sometimes called the “law of inertia,” tells us that bodies maintain their current velocity unless a net force is applied to change it. Webb26 jan. 2024 · When two particles are connected with a string and the string passes over a fixed pulley, then we assume a few restrictions that we must remember when solving such problems: 1) We assume that the string is light. 2) The string is inextensible 3) Pulley is smooth 4) Pulley is fixed 5) Air resistance is not taken into account. WebbYes! Look down on this motion. We have uniform circular motion! So we know a_x = v^2/R, pointing towards the center of the circle of motion. Here R is the radius of the circle the ball is rotating around. That’s not L, it’s the radius of the “flat plane” circular motion.
